Как обычно с небольшим опозданием 🙂
публикуем решения для нашей
последней головоломки
.

Задание 1.

В первом задании даны две таблицы.

Внимательно смотрим на первую таблицу, она составлена из «1» и «0»,
в связи с чем можно предположить, что это двоичный код.

Для примера рассмотрим первую строку:

1101010 0110010 0110100 1100011 0110001 0110110

Теперь осталось только перевести в ASCII и получаем:

j24-c16

Аналогично поступаем с остальными строками первый таблицы и получаем:

j24c16 
a24a1 
a24g2 
a24g8 
a24e16 
a24c16 
a24e16 
a24i3 
j24g2
a24n14 
j24a2
j24c16 
a24e16 
a24c16

У нас осталась вторая неиспользованная таблица, очевидно решение кроется в ней.
Внимательно изучив полученные из первой таблицы строки, можно заметить они очень
напоминают указатели. Берем вторую таблицу и делаем разметку, по вертикали
нумеруем a..n, по горизонтали 1..43. Теперь берем первую полученную из предыдущей таблицы строку «j24c16»
и используем ее в качестве координат во второй таблице.

«j-24» указывает на символ «7», «c-16» на «4», аналогично поступаем с остальными строками
и получаем: 

74 
61 
62 
6C 
65 
64 
65 
63 
72 
69 
70 
74 
65 
64

Пробуем перевести полученные числа в ASCII, но ничего связного не выходит,
поэтому пробуем представить их как шестнадцатиричные и получаем:

tabledecrypted

Задание выполнено.

Задание 2.

Дана картинка с двумя рядами цветов. Внимательно смотрим на первый ряд
— ни один из цветов не повторяется, можно предположить, что в ней сосредоточен латинский алфавит,
т.е. каждый цвет — буква начиная от A..Z. Теперь легко расшифровываем вторую строку и получаем:

biospherethecolorcipher

Задание выполнено.

Задание 3.

Используем любой декомпилятор class-апплетов. К примеру программу
DeJava, после того как апплет будет декомпилирован найти пароль очень просто.

Пароль: modulation

Задание выполнено.

Задание 4.

Из 4 задания при вводе правильного пароля апплет автоматически запросит
пятое задание с сервера с именем файла именно modulation.exe.

В программе нет ничего сложного, декомпилируем приложение с помощью
декомпилятора, к примеру WINDASM, место проверки пароля можно быстро
найти с помощью отладчика, далее разобрав кусок кода проверки составляем
небольшую программку для поиска верных символов по хэшу и получаем пароль:

congratulationyousuccesfullycrackthischallenge

Задание выполнено.

Оставить мнение

Check Also

Мошенничество по воздуху. Разбираем возможность Cryptogram Replay Attack в Apple Pay

Задача платежной системы — списать нужную сумму в пользу продавца со счета верное число ра…